Summary
MOVIETONE CARD TITLE: Duke Visits South Wales. SHOTLIST: Cut story - KS. GV Swansea Bay. Inside Mayor’s Parlour, signs book. Group - Mayor & Duke, & other officials inside. Leaving Town Hall. Drives through crowded streets, cut-in cheering crowds. Duke walks through crowds. Car arrives at hospital, nurses cheer, Duke turns & acknowledges cheers before entering. Interior - Duke stops & talks (silent) to several patients including ex-Mayor of Swansea. Next day, Duke arrives at Abbey Works, Margam, various shots of him going round, watching coke oven being emptied, board diesel engine loco, rides through works. Interior - arrives at Power Station, Duke turns on controls. CU hands turning wheel. Duke signs book. Workmen look on. In melting shops, Duke watches process through blue-glass.
